The first Guantanamo detainee to be brought to the US for trial has pleaded not guilty to involvement in two embassy blasts in East Africa in 1998. Ahmed Ghailani, the very first inmate of Guantanmo, appeared before a federal court in New York, after being transferred there earlier in the day. He was detained in Pakistan in 2004 and taken to Guantanamo in late 2006. The case is seen as a test of the Obama administration’s pledge to close Guantanamo Bay by next January.
